Output e8f88c421523ab6f62e596177fad8158b1fd41c0e1aa7e8ed3ad9e537f823407:1

value
13647789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ca0e428635d7c3631effefcc0a0a04236034d6a OP_EQUAL
address
3BbPeBSg6f71EBDpUmtfJKPisdeQEVbUmX
transaction
e8f88c421523ab6f62e596177fad8158b1fd41c0e1aa7e8ed3ad9e537f823407
spent
true